Specifies the scaling factor for the respawn rate for resource nodes (trees, rocks, bushes, etc.). Lower values cause nodes to respawn more frequently.

Allow resources to regrow closer or farther away from players & structures. Values higher than 1 increase the distance around players and structures where resources are allowed to grow back. Values between 0 and 1 will reduce it.
does anyone know where I can find this settings in the ini file? I belive this will help prevent crap from growing back so fast as well.
\Config\WindowsServer\Game.ini
[/script/shootergame.shootergamemode]
ResourceNoReplenishRadiusPlayers=1
ResourceNoReplenishRadiusStructures=1
